This research presents a uniform approximation to the formulas of Benade and Keefe for the propagation constant of a cylindrical tube, valid for all tube radii and frequencies in the audio range. Based on this approximation, a simple expression is presented for a filter which closely matches the thermoviscous loss filter of a tube of specified length and radius at a given sampling rate. The form of this filter and the simplicity of coefficient calculation make it particularly suitable for real-time music applications where it may be desirable to have tube parameters such as length and radius vary during performance.
